lol it's a picture of Michael Moore, director of Fahrenheit 911 which is coming out this weekend. I would advise everyone to bet the over at WSEX on this puppy even though it's now at -260. i'm not going to call it a lock because that's just gonna jinx me. But it's a top 3 play of the year, I won the last time I bet a dime on a movie and I don't plan on losing 2.